3. Local-First Data Principle

Renota is designed so that your original recordings and local note content remain on your Mac by default.

However, "local-first" does not mean no data ever leaves your device. Some features require limited data transfer, such as account login, payment, seed user application forms, analytics, support, or AI processing that you initiate.
